Catalyst Paper Mill changes its name to reconcile with First Nation
Catalyst Paper Mill changes its name to reconcile with First Nation

The Catalyst mill is changing its name, in collaboration with Tla'amin Nation. The Paper Excellence company mill will now be called tiskʷat (tees-kwat); the English translation is 'big river.'

Rayonier Advanced Materials announces Cellulose Specialties price hike
Rayonier Advanced Materials announces Cellulose Specialties price hike

Rayonier Advanced Materials Inc. announced that, effective immediately, it will increase prices for all its Cellulose Specialties products by a minimum 15 to 30 percent depending on product grade, as contracts allow.

Mexico fines tampon, diaper makers for price fixing
Mexico fines tampon, diaper makers for price fixing

The companies fined were Essity México, Kimberly Clark de México and Productos Internacionales Mabe. The commission said Mabe did not fix prices on tampons, but did on diapers.
